User Experience: The Battle of Accessibility Versus Expertise
One of the primary discussions on Reddit revolves around the user experience offered by each platform. Coinbase is often praised for its simplicity and ease of use, making it an ideal choice for first-time investors or those looking to dabble in cryptocurrencies without delving into complex trading strategies. Its interface is straightforward, with a focus on buying, selling, and storing digital assets.
On the other hand, Binance has garnered admiration from users who appreciate its advanced features and capabilities. It offers a platform tailored for traders and professionals, boasting an extensive range of cryptocurrencies, low fees, and constant innovation in trading technologies like margin trading and staking. The community on Reddit is divided over whether this expertise comes at the cost of accessibility for newcomers, with some users arguing that Binance's depth requires a certain level of understanding to navigate effectively.
User Preferences and Recommendations
Reddit serves as a platform where users share their experiences, offering advice to others based on their preferences. For instance, many users recommend Coinbase to friends and family who are new to cryptocurrency due to its user-friendly nature and support for various payment methods. However, experienced traders often turn to Binance for the liquidity it offers in a wide array of cryptocurrencies and the benefits of commission rebates.
A significant portion of discussions on Reddit also revolve around the scalability and regulatory considerations of each platform. Coinbase's adherence to strict regulations within the United States has been noted as one of its strengths, ensuring that it can offer services to a broader customer base without compromising on security. Conversely, Binance's reputation for rapid expansion into new markets allows it to sometimes bypass legal hurdles but also raises concerns about regulatory scrutiny and how this might affect users in the long term.
Security and Safety: Balancing Innovation with Stability
Security is a critical concern among cryptocurrency enthusiasts, and discussions on Reddit often delve into how Coinbase and Binance handle user funds and implement security measures. Both platforms are known for their robust safety protocols, including two-factor authentication, cold storage wallets, and insurance policies to mitigate risks. However, users express concerns about the potential vulnerabilities of innovative features offered by Binance, such as fast trading and cross-chain assets, questioning if these advancements come with a higher risk profile compared to Coinbase's more conservative approach.
